Jolantean marriage part 2.
With the Karineans behaving as they did, conflict was inevitable.
It came some hundred years later, when King Andrew of Karine's daughter, Princess Rowene, was cursed to bring about the death of her father.
Such a thing is horrible in any country, particularly when your father is a good man, such as King Andrew was, so the daughter was sent to her relatives for safety.
Now King Andrew was a more tolerant man than his subjects, and had wed a lady from Jolant- her name was struck from history books in Karine after the "incident", as they called it. So the princess was sent to Jolant to live. Years passed, the princess grew into a fine and good-hearted young lady, and her father began looking for a new wife. As fate would have it, he went to Jolant to find one.
He met his daughter - unknowingly they fell in love and they married, and returned to to Karine in great happiness. Eventually they discovered their relationship to one another, and as they were in love, the king had it proclaimed that his daughter had caught sickness and died, so they would not be found out. It did not last. The truth of their relationship was found out, and the princess was burnt at the stake as a witch. The king, heartbroken, committed suicide, and the princess went down in Karinean history books as a great villain. To us, she is a martyr, and women name their daughters for her.
Since then, the relationship between the two countries has not been the best, although I have just learned that Prince Henri of Karine, heir to the throne, has become engaged to our Grand Duchess Roxane, sister of the current Duchess Ravensbrook. I do believe there is a change in the air.

Jolantean characters: Rowene February.
Rowene February is a ballet-dancer in the opera house at the moment, as she has no plans of doing anything else.
She was Jolantean-born, in the eastern part of Jolant. She wasn't born a human, but a bear. She was turned into a human as a child by a witch practicing her magic.
I took inspiration for Rowene's backstory from the 1978 Russian fairytale film An Ordinary Miracle, and my headcanon for Jolantean magic is that it contrasts to Karinean magic. Karinean magic is easy to use, but Jolantean magic, when used, causes side effects.
The side effect Rowene received was the inability to speak. She has been mute ever since, and speaks by ballet mine to her friends and writing to everyone else.
After she was turned into a human, the witch, feeling sorry for her, took her in and taught her how to be a human, and her parents were shot by a hunter, so she's never gone back home.
My original intent for Rowene was to pair her with Prince Magnus of Karine, in a novella that would resolve the conflict between Jolant and Karine. However, one day I was brainstorming and I thought, "What if I swapped Rowene and Lisella around and gave Rowene Lisella's storyline?" And the storyline for Lisella's tale changed to reflect the heroine.
More on that in another post.
Rowene is shy and retiring, but has a good heart and a kind soul. She also owns a black cat for luck, named Edgar.
